中文摘要:
      采用复分解反应方法制备肉桂酸锌(ZDBA),研究ZDBA用量对氢化丁腈橡胶(HNBR)胶料性能的影响。结果表明:肉桂酸通过复分解反应可以生成ZDBA,其收率为97.8%,锌含量为18.1%;随着ZDBA用量的增大,HNBR胶料的Fmax-FL逐渐增大,硫化胶的邵尔A型硬度和100%定伸应力呈增大趋势,拉伸强度、拉断伸长率和撕裂强度呈先增大后减小的趋势。
英文摘要:
      Zinc cinnamate(ZDBA) was prepared by the metathesis reaction,and the effect of amount of ZDBA on the properties of hydrogenated nitrile rubber(HNBR) compound was studied.The results showed that cinnamic acid could generate ZDBA through metathesis reaction,its yield was 97.8%,and the zinc content was 18.1%.As the amount of ZDBA increased,the Fmax-FL of the HNBR compound gradually increased,and the Shore A hardness and modulus at 100% of the vulcanizate trended to increase,the tensile strength,elongation at break and tear strength trended to increase first and then decrease.
